The Cost of Survival in Night City: A Cultural Analysis of Cyberpunk: Edgerunners

The Cyberpunk genre has long served as a grim mirror to our technological and social trajectories, defined by the core maxim: "high tech, low life". Among its most potent modern interpretations is the anime series Cyberpunk: Edgerunners

, which revitalized the franchise by grounding high-concept sci-fi in a deeply personal, tragic human story. By exploring the narrative through the lens of archival preservation and digital accessibility, we can better understand how this "metacultural movement" continues to resonate in the 21st century. High Tech, Low Life: The Narrative Core At its heart, Cyberpunk: Edgerunners

follows David Martinez, a talented street kid who, after losing everything in a drive-by shooting, chooses to survive on the fringes of society as a mercenary outlaw—an "edgerunner". The series masterfully illustrates the systemic exploitation of Night City, where social status is literally equated with physical height; the ultra-rich occupy penthouses while the "punks" scramble for survival in the urban slums below.

This setting serves as a playground for the genre’s most enduring themes:

The Dehumanizing Cost of Enhancement: The series portrays the tragic reality of cybernetic over-extension, leading to "cyberpsychosis" and the loss of self.

Systemic Inequality: Corporations control all natural resources, leaving individuals to resist through hacking and black-market activities.

The Futility of Ambition: The ending is intentionally tragic, highlighting the impossibility of rising within a corrupt hierarchy without losing one's soul. Preservation and Accessibility

Critics and fans alike have praised the series for its bold visual style and emotional depth. While the animation style differs from the realism of the original Cyberpunk 2077 game, viewers quickly become engaged by the strong character writing and the visceral, "bloody and brutal" portrayal of violence. What is Cyberpunk: Edgerunners?

Before jumping into the archives, it’s worth remembering why this show took the world by storm. Produced by Studio Trigger in collaboration with CD Projekt Red, Edgerunners isn't just a spin-off of the Cyberpunk 2077 game—it’s a standalone masterpiece. It follows David Martinez, a street kid who loses everything and decides to survive by becoming an "edgerunner"—a mercenary outlaw equipped with high-tech "cyberware" that threatens to consume his humanity. What is Cyberpunk: Edgerunners?

"Cyberpunk: Edgerunners" is a cyberpunk anime series produced by Studio Trigger, the creative minds behind other notable anime shows like "Kill la Kill" and "Little Witch Academia." The series serves as a standalone entry in the Cyberpunk franchise, which originated with the release of the iconic video game "Cyberpunk 2077."

The story follows David Martinez, a young and ambitious edgerunner in the sprawling metropolis of Night City. As a mercenary and a thrill-seeker, David navigates the dark, high-tech underworld, taking on missions and facing off against formidable foes. Alongside his companions, he explores the blurred lines between human and machine, delving into themes of corporate greed, artificial intelligence, and what it means to be human.
